1. Introduction
Object detection is an essential component in autonomous driving, ensuring the identification of pedestrians, vehicles, traffic signals, and obstacles to enhance safety. The advancement of the deep-learning approach and the availability of diverse data have led to robust and accurate models for object detection [18]. However, object detection in challenging weather conditions like snow, fog, and rain results in reduced accuracy due to obscurity/absence of salient object features, noise from weather patterns (rain streaks and snowflakes), lens interference, and decreased ambient light.